I've spent a couple hours trying to find the CRS for this data and haven't found anything that seems to work. Based on the "DATUM" attribute on an entry like this one, I've been looking for information on ITRF08. There's entries like this one in epsg.io, but they don't produce an image in the right place on earth. I'm still looking for the right projection.
Once I do find the right projection, there are a couple changes I need to do to make the transcode step work:
- The environment variables need to get updated to include the
.xyzfile type - The transcode.sh script needs to get updated to find a
.xyzfile inside a.zipfile

The transcoding finished and we ended up with 2,516 footprints in the database. This doesn't come close to covering Mexico, though:

This regex filter in the URL listing step cut out most of the ~50k images from the portal. I think the rest of the images are "surface" (i.e. with buildings) images?
The data that did make it in looks pretty nice, though:

I've poked around a bit on other pieces of the data at INEGI this morning and there's more to pull in, but almost none of it has valid projection information in a machine-readable format. I'm going to call it quits for now, as the next step (digging through 50,000 URLs to find a pattern in projection information) is vastly more time-consuming.
